The Impact and Benefits of Mindful Parenting

The benefits of mindful parenting can be significant. First and foremost, it supports emotional regulation in children and parents alike. By teaching children mindful breathing and other mindfulness practices, parents can help children develop healthy emotional regulation skills.

Mindful parenting mindful parenting also has the potential to reduce stress and anxiety in everyday life. As parents become more fully present with their feelings and reactions, they can manage stress more effectively, which can make all the difference in their interactions with their children.

Moreover, practicing mindful parenting becomes especially vital when it comes to nurturing children’s mental well-being and helping children develop resilience to cope with the fast-paced world.

Insights into Mindful Parenting Challenges and Solutions

Taking time for mindful parenting in today’s modern life can be challenging. Parents may feel like they are caught in a whirlwind of activities and commitments, and finding the space to practice mindfulness in daily life can seem daunting.

But remember, mindful parenting doesn’t need to be complicated or time-consuming. It can be as simple as slowing down, being fully present in the moment with your child, and practicing active listening.
